kjw13   4년 전

어떤 예외케이스가 있는 것일까요...

1207koo   4년 전

4

4 2 1 3

kjw13   4년 전

수정했습니다 다시 봐주실수 있나요??

1207koo   4년 전

8

2 8 6 1 5 4 3 7

park780172   4년 전

LIS 알고리즘을 참고하시면 될 것 같습니다.

1207koo   4년 전

사실 지금 코드가 복잡해서 이해가 가질 않습니다.

그리고 맞는 풀이라고 해도 훨씬 간단하게 풀 수 있고요.

그리고 29번째 줄이 3번째 for문입니다. N^3일 가능성이 있고, 웬만해서는 N^3으로는 힘들 수 있습니다.(물론 가능할 수도 있긴 합니다)

kjw13   4년 전

고려해서 고쳤는데 이번에는 80%에서 틀렸다고 나오네요..

아 그 29번째 for문은 만약 증가하지 않는 값이 나오는 경우에 이전 값들과 부분수열이 성립한다면 ck라는 배열의 해당되는 위치에 부분수열의 마지막 숫자중 1을 더해 수열을 넣어주는 원리입니다. 설명하기 어렵네요 ㅠㅠ 일단 반레 찾아주셔서 감사합니다!!

kjw13   4년 전

지금 확인해보니 3  1 1 1 과 같은 하나의 수열이 발생하는 경우를 고려 안하였습니다. 다시 해보고 질문있으면 하겠습니다 ㅠㅠ

kjw13   4년 전

해결했습니다.. 근데 역시 시간이 좀 빠듯해지더군요.. 효율적으로 짜려고 노력해야할 것 같습니다

댓글을 작성하려면 로그인해야 합니다.